Market Overview
Managed testing services refer to the outsourcing of software quality assurance and testing functions to specialized third-party providers, covering functional, automation, performance, and security testing capabilities. The market is valued at approximately $55.8 billion in 2026 and is growing at a compound annual growth rate of 14.05%, reflecting robust demand across enterprise digitalization initiatives. Growth trajectories indicate the sector will continue expanding rapidly through the 2030s as organizations prioritize software reliability and accelerated release cycles.

Growth Drivers
The proliferation of cloud-native applications, mobile platforms, and regulatory compliance requirements are primary catalysts for managed testing adoption. Enterprises increasingly outsource testing to reduce time-to-market, access specialized skill sets, and manage the complexity of multi-platform testing environments. Additionally, the shift toward DevOps and continuous integration/continuous deployment pipelines has elevated the importance of automated and managed testing frameworks.

Segmentation and Regional Analysis
The market is segmented by service type into functional testing, automation testing, performance testing, and security testing, with automation testing representing a significant and expanding share. By end-user industry, BFSI, healthcare, retail and e-commerce, IT and telecom, and government sectors constitute the primary demand pillars. Geographically, North America and Europe currently hold the largest market shares, while Asia-Pacific is projected to exhibit the fastest growth due to expanding IT infrastructure and outsourcing activity.

Competitive Landscape

The managed testing services market exhibits moderate fragmentation, shaped by two distinct producer archetypes and their contrasting positioning strategies. Large-scale integrated IT services firms, including Capgemini SE and Wipro Ltd, leverage extensive delivery footprints and cross-service synergies, bundling testing within broader application development and infrastructure engagements to serve enterprise accounts. In contrast, pure-play specialists such as Qualitest Ltd compete through deep vertical domain mastery and purpose-built testing methodologies, targeting clients that prioritize testing-specific expertise over breadth. Meanwhile, BMC occupies a differentiated position rooted in its software and automation pedigree, emphasizing intelligent test orchestration and AI-driven platforms integrated into clients' DevOps and value-stream management workflows. Across all tiers, producers are converging on AI-assisted test automation, cloud-native testing infrastructure, and continuous testing frameworks, though they diverge sharply on whether to lead with platform depth or service-layer breadth as the primary competitive lever.

Trends and Outlook

AI-powered test automation and continuous testing embedded in DevOps workflows represent the most significant evolutionary trends shaping the market trajectory. The convergence of testing with observability and quality engineering functions is redefining service offerings beyond traditional testing boundaries. The market is expected to maintain its 14.05% compound annual growth rate through the early 2030s, with enterprise adoption of cloud-native and microservices architectures sustaining demand for advanced managed testing capabilities.
